Subject: Handover — Larkspur invoice renderer

Welcome aboard. The Larkspur PDF invoice renderer runs as a nightly batch: it pulls billed line items, renders PDFs, and writes a checksum back per invoice. Known quirks: the template cache must be cleared after any layout change, and reruns are idempotent only if the checksum column is intact. Monitoring is the batch dashboard; alerts page the billing rotation, not us. First task: verify last night's run counts. The billing database is reachable with the string below.

replica DSN, kajep-yahag: mssql://praok_svc:iF@db-8d68.plorvaio.local:5432/eliion

## Scrubjay Environments

Scrubjay strips EXIF from all uploaded images. Three environments: dev, staging, prod. Dev keeps originals for 24h for debugging; staging and prod delete immediately after scrub. GPS, serial, and timestamp tags removed everywhere; orientation preserved. Support note: if a customer reports missing rotation, check staging first — prod and staging share the same tag allowlist, dev does not. Escalate scrub failures to the pipeline team, not storage. Current production scrub settings are listed below.

deployment values, yadug-bawif:
[framir]
team = pelox
access_code = ac_a38ab2
owner = tamion.julael
host = framir.tolvaqlabs.test
port = 11211
peer = tammir.zemvargrid.local
salt = 2215ef03
pin = 1541

## Break-Glass Access: Routewise Driver-Assignment Heuristic

External plugin authors normally interact with the Routewise heuristic through the sandboxed scoring API. If the sandbox gateway fails and a production incident requires direct inspection of assignment decisions, break-glass access grants temporary read access to the live scoring logs. Invocations are audited and expire after one hour. Coordinate with the Routewise duty engineer before use. The recovery passphrase that activates break-glass mode appears below.

unlock words, kagef-taduf: fenir-quenix-norwyn-sorvan-gormir-gorir-fraok